For Lack There Of

Accidental Poet



 

There’s a void in the world

A void that has always needed more

Love in the hearts of people

Peace and understanding behind that door

 

Love to take the place of

Hatred, vengeance and violence

For people to come together

Communicate and end the silence

 

If we are to grow as a species

And not cause our own demise

We need to see love in ourselves

And finally open our eyes

 

We were not put on this Earth

To birth its destruction

We need the building blocks of love

To begin its reconstruction

 

Let’s wipe the slate clean

Put aside all weapons of arms 

Fill our world with love

Embrace with unified arms

 

Or we will destroy ourselves

Animals, mammals and plant life too

The Earth a dead burnt out planet

A sad ending view

 

But maybe it’s not too late

If we can dig down deep for love

To love our world and everyone in it

The lack there of
